Variations:
The Jumbuck mini spit comes in two variations
Now, what'۪s the difference you may be asking? Well, it's really quite simple. The "Novo" comes supplied with a battery-operated motor. This is perfect where you don't have access to mains 240v power when you are out camping or travelling or just don't have external power at your house.
The "Rondo" is the electric version that runs on 240v mains power.
The decision on which to buy from Bunnings Warehouse is totally up to your circumstances. However, you can get the best of both worlds and buy the other motor if you want options. Perhaps you want the electricity for home and the battery when you are out camping. I will note that these motors are EXTREMELY energy efficient, so you will get many cooks from the batteries. One main consideration when buying the Jumbuck and where you can tell the units are made at a price point. Is the use of 'chrome' skewers and prongs. Over time, the chrome may chip or break down, and potentially, that metal could contaminate your food. We always recommend to our customers to invest in better quality spit accessories that are 304 food-grade stainless steel, just for peace of mind.
Ease of use: When it comes to assembly, there really isn۪t that much to do with the Jumbuck Mini Spit. Simply attach the legs to the body of the spit, attach an air vent, put on the uprights to support the skewer and you are pretty much ready to go. It really is that simple.
The simplicity of this unit is why it is generating so much popularity across Australia, I dare say 100s of thousands of units have been sold and for good reason. The product is solid. Cooking is easy. Load up your skewer, light some charcoal, turn on the motor, and you are cooking in minutes. What's not to love about that?

Improvements I'd like to see:
The skewer support on the jumbuck mini spit is a bit whimsy, meaning one side of the skewer can fall, especially while carving. However, this is probably me just being a bit nitpicky more than an actual issue with the unit.
